How to Choose the Right Free AI Floor Plan Tool for Your Architecture Practice
With seven strong options on the table, the right choice depends entirely on your workflow stage and output goal. In practice, most architects don’t rely on just one tool—they mix a few depending on the project stage. Here is a practical framework to guide your decision:
Stage 1 — Early Ideation and Client Briefing
Use ChatGPT + DALL·E 3 or RoomGPT. These tools are optimized for speed and visual exploration. They help you present multiple spatial concepts to clients before investing time in detailed drawings.
Stage 2 — Developing a Real Floor Plan Layout
Move to Planner 5D or Floorplanner.com. These platforms offer scale-accurate room placement, real furniture libraries, and 2D/3D visualization — everything you need to develop a real design proposal.
Stage 3 — Professional Production and CAD Integration
Use Maket.AI with its DXF export functionality. This bridges your AI-generated layouts directly into your professional CAD workflow.
Stage 4 — Client Presentations and Pitching
Use Adobe Firefly and Canva AI to produce stunning visual presentations that communicate your design intent with maximum impact.

5 Expert Tips for Getting the Best Results from Free AI Floor Plan Generators
These tips are based on how designers actually use AI tools in real projects—not just theory. Even the best tools produce mediocre results without effective prompting. Here are five expert-level tips specifically for architects:
1. Be Specific About Your Spatial Program
Do not just say "3-bedroom house." Tell the AI: "3-bedroom, 2-bathroom single-story home with an open-plan kitchen-dining area, south-facing living room, home office, and a double garage." The more specific your brief, the more relevant the AI output will be.
2. Use Iterative Refinement, Not Single Prompts
Treat AI floor plan generation like a design conversation. Start broad, evaluate the output, then refine with follow-up prompts: "Make the kitchen larger," "Move the master bedroom to the north wing," "Add a utility room adjacent to the kitchen."
3. Always Check Room Proportions Against Real-World Standards
AI tools are excellent at layout relationships but sometimes generate rooms with unrealistic proportions. Always verify that bedroom sizes, corridor widths, and bathroom dimensions meet local building codes and ergonomic standards before advancing to detailed design.
4. Combine Multiple Tools for a Complete Workflow
Using AI tools at different stages — ideation, layout, visualization, presentation — dramatically improves both the quality and speed of your output. No single free tool does everything perfectly.
5. Use AI Outputs as Starting Points, Not Final Deliverables
AI-generated floor plans are powerful starting points for human creativity — they should inspire and accelerate your design thinking, not replace it. Always apply your professional judgment, site knowledge, and client understanding to refine AI suggestions into genuinely excellent architecture.

Can AI really generate usable architectural floor plans for free?
Yes — and in 2026, the quality has improved dramatically. Tools like Planner 5D, Floorplanner.com, and Maket.AI (free trial) generate scale-accurate, spatially logical floor plans that serve as excellent starting points for professional architectural work. They should always be reviewed and refined by a qualified architect before use in actual construction.
Are AI-generated floor plans accurate enough for actual construction?
Not directly. AI floor plan generators are optimized for conceptual design and early-stage ideation, not production-ready construction documentation. Final construction documents must always be produced by a licensed architect using professional CAD or BIM software with proper structural, mechanical, and electrical coordination.
Which free AI tool generates the most realistic floor plans?
For the most technically accurate free floor plans, Floorplanner.com and Planner 5D are the top choices — both work at real-world scale and include extensive furniture libraries. For professional-grade layouts with CAD export, Maket.AI's free trial is the most powerful option currently available.
Do I need design experience to use these AI floor plan tools?
No — most tools on this list are designed to be accessible to non-architects. Canva AI, RoomGPT, and ChatGPT require no design experience. Planner 5D and Floorplanner.com have gentle learning curves. Maket.AI is slightly more technical but still far more intuitive than professional CAD software.
Are there any free AI tools that export directly to AutoCAD format?
Yes — Maket.AI supports DXF export in its free trial, which is compatible with AutoCAD. Other tools on this list export to PNG or PDF on free tiers. If CAD-compatible export is critical to your workflow, Maket.AI is your best free-trial option.
How do AI floor plan generators handle complex architectural programs?
Current AI tools handle simple to moderately complex programs well — single-family homes, small offices, apartments. For highly complex programs like hospitals or multi-story mixed-use developments, AI tools are best used for early ideation only. More advanced program handling is expected in late 2026 and 2027.
